Trustworthy application integration
According to some embodiments, methods and systems may be associated with trustworthy application integration. A formalization platform may facilitate definition of pattern requirements by an integration developer. The formalization platform may also formalize singe pattern compositions and compose single patterns to template-based formalized compositions. A correctness platform may then check for structural correctness of the formalized compositions and execute a semantic transformation or binding to pattern characteristics and associated interactions. The correctness platform may also check composition semantics and generate a formal model. An implementation platform may translate the formal model generated by the correctness platform and configure implementation parameters of the translated formal model. The implementation platform may then execute the translated formal model in accordance with the configured implementation parameters.

Hyperpiler
An improved method for generating complex formal language documents from simple input values, reducing the barrier to formal communications. The techniques described may be applied to different domains to generate different types of documents requiring formal language. For illustration, this disclosure focuses on generating a computer program document as programming languages are among the most formal.

Methods and systems for generating application build recommendations
Methods and systems for managing an online application database and application search. Search queries for applications are received from users. Unfulfilled queries are stored in memory. The platform identifies one or more application features based on the search queries within the stored unfulfilled queries, and generates an application build recommendation specifying the one or more application features. The application build recommendation is output to one or more developer accounts. If a new application is received, the platform may determine whether the new application contains features that sufficiently correspond to the features in one of the application build recommendations. User accounts that submitted the unfulfilled queries that served as the basis for the matching application build recommendation may be notified of the availability of the new application.

Next generation digitized modeling system and methods
A system and method are disclosed for creating solution design blueprints. A solution design blueprint is a machine-readable data structure that includes a conceptual design model for an application framework. A user interface is configured to receive a plain language textual request from a user that describes a desired application or solution to a problem. Artificial Intelligence is leveraged to fit the textual request to semantic data models and map elements of the textual request to components of a design library. The resulting solution design blueprint can be presented to a user, and the user interface can be used to provide feedback related to the solution design blueprint that can be utilized to update machine learning algorithms and/or neural networks. In some embodiments, the solution design blueprint can be converted to an application framework that is provided to the use in an integrated development environment of the user interface.

COMPLIANCE CONTENT GENERATION
A content generation method includes receiving a control document comprising one or more control clauses, identifying actionable content for the one or more control clauses, generating a programming language template for the one or more control clauses, identifying a closest existing control clause from a database for each of the one or more control clause, identifying a programming language implementation of the closest existing control clause, identifying similarities and differences between the programming language implementation and the generated programming language template, and annotating the programming language implementation for the closest existing control clause based on the identified similarities and differences. The method may additionally include determining whether a closest existing control clause exists, providing the generated programming language template to a user responsive to determining that a closest existing control clause does not exist, and receiving feedback from the user regarding the generated programming language template.
